数据表格、布局网格、分录表格傻傻分不清?这篇使用指南帮你厘清!
苍穹打印设计器内置丰富的控件,包括文本、图片、二维码、条形码等通用控件,以及数据表格、分录表格、布局网格、页眉页脚等容器控件,多方位满足用户打印业务单据的需求,轻松实现数据套打。
但不少小伙伴在设计打印模板时,不清楚是使用数据表格、布局网格还是分录表格来实现需求,或者是错用控件导致打印效果不符合预期,如单据分录显示不完整等。
本期文章,小编为大家依次梳理了数据表格、布局网格和分录表格控件的基本功能和选择指引,并在文末总结了区别和适用场景。看完这篇指南,包你清晰不少~
1 数据表格、布局网格、分录表格基本介绍
1.1 数据表格
数据表格以明细表格样式纵向打印绑定的单据内容,常用于打印单据的明细内容,如采购单的产品明细、差旅报销单的费用明细。通常数据表格的数据源是同一个单据体,分录数据存在多条且分录数据不确定,支持绑定子数据表格。
数据表格的操作类似Excel,支持删除、插入行/列、合并单元格、单元格样式编辑、行高列宽设置等便捷操作。
数据表格包含4种行类型:
标题行:用于设计打印明细表格的表头标题,选中标题行的单元格时,支持输入文本或绑定字段
数据行:用于展示所绑定明细表的数据字段,选中数据行的单元格时,支持输入文本或绑定字段(仅支持单据体和工作流字段)
合计行:用于合计某个子表字段,合计类型包含不合计、累计求和、每页求和,选中数据行的单元格时,支持输入文本或绑定字段(合计行不支持行高自适应)
分组行:添加分组行,可针对不同的分录数据进行分组打印,并支持不同的分组数据分页打印,还可进行分组合计。详细分组打印使用技巧,见文章:https://vip.kingdee.com/link/s/lvTpB
除了分组打印,数据表格还支持相同分录行合并汇总、分录排序、分录过滤打印,无需二开,简单配置即可实现,非常实用~
相同分录行合并汇总:选中数据行,通过配置合并依据字段和合并汇总字段即可实现相同分录行合并汇总打印,如打印采购收货单物料明细数据时,选择“物料名称”为合并依据字段,“物料数量”为合并汇总字段,则打印时,会将相同物料名称的分录行合并,并将同一类物料名称对应的物料数量合并相加。详细使用技巧,见文章:https://vip.kingdee.com/link/s/lvTQe
分录排序设置:通过在控件属性【排序设置】中配置排序字段和排序方式,即可实现将分录按特定字段顺序排序。详细使用技巧,见文章:https://vip.kingdee.com/link/s/lv3sF
分录过滤打印:通过过滤条件配置,可筛选出符合特定条件的分录数据进行打印。详细使用技巧,见文章:https://vip.kingdee.com/link/s/lvjTO
更多数据表格使用指引,可参考文章:数据表格使用方法一网打尽,你的单据打印需求我来满足!
1.2 布局网格
布局网格常用于设计个人履历模板或用表格辅助布局,支持自定义设计网格大小。网格的每个单元格都可输入文本或绑定字段。与数据表格不同的是,单元格不仅可嵌入文本和字段,还可嵌入图片、二维码、条形码控件(每个单元格只支持绑定一个控件)。注:V6.0及以上版本,数据表格支持嵌套图片、二维码等控件。
同样地,布局网格的操作类似Excel,支持删除、插入行/列、合并/拆分单元格、单元格样式编辑等便捷操作。单元格中常输入文本或绑定字段。
关于布局网格的详细用法,可参考文章:https://vip.kingdee.com/link/s/lvjI3
1.3 分录表格
分录表格同样适用于打印分录明细数据,但与数据表格不同,分录可以更改分录数据打印的表格样式,可自由设计表格布局,如打印资产卡片,资产的信息为单据体,通过分录表格可实现将分录数据打印成资产卡片的样式。
分录表格数据源支持绑定单据体、子单据体、自定义数据源、关联数据源单据体、报表、工作流,且每个单元格支持嵌套文本、图片、二维码、条形码控件,再绑定相应数据源。与数据表格相同,分录表格也支持配置过滤条件实现分录过滤打印。
此外,分录表格可通过设置分录表格间隔(0-50mm)实现分录表格间隔打印,也可通过开启“按分录分页打印”实现分录表格分页打印。
关于分录表格的详细使用方法,可参考文章:https://vip.kingdee.com/link/s/lvsyV
2 如何选择数据表格、布局网格、分录表格
从前文可知,数据表格、布局网格和分录表格控件功能都很强大,但适用场景有所不同,因此,在实际应用时,应根据具体的业务场景需求灵活选择合适的控件来设计打印模板。此处总结了一些常见场景的控件选择建议,供大家参考:
1. 如果需要打印所有分录明细数据,建议优先使用数据表格(布局网格只能取到明细分录中的第一条分录)。进一步地,若在打印分录明细数据的基础上,还需要自定义分录数据打印的表格样式,可通过分录表格实现。
2. 如果无需打印分录明细数据,仅需要通过表格来辅助布局,如设计个人履历模板等场景,可通过布局网格来实现。
3. 如果需要在表格中嵌套图片/二维码/条形码等控件,则建议使用分录表格或布局网格(V6.0及以上,数据表格支持嵌套控件)。进一步地,若需在每条明细分录行都有对应的图片/二维码/条形码,则可通过分录表格来实现。
4. 如果需要实现分录按特定字段顺序排序打印,可通过数据表格-排序设置实现。
5. 如果需要实现相同分录行合并汇总打印,或根据不同的分组条件打印每个分组内的分录明细内容,可通过数据表格的合并汇总功能或分组打印功能实现。
3 划重点
数据表格、布局网格和分录表格的主要应用场景和功能区别如下表所示,在实际应用时,应根据具体的业务场景需求灵活选择合适的控件来设计打印模板:
控件 | 适用版本 | 主要应用场景 | 场景示例 | 支持嵌套图片/二维码/条形码 | 支持打印全部分录数据 | 支持分录 过滤打印 | 支持分录排序打印 | 支持相同分录行合并汇总打印 | 支持分组打印 |
数据表格 | BOSV4.0.004及以上 | 以明细表格样式纵向打印绑定的单据内容,常用于打印单据的明细内容 | 打印采购单的产品明细、差旅报销单的费用明细 | V6.0及以上版本支持 | √ | √ | √ | √ | √ |
布局网格 | BOSV4.0.004及以上 | 常用于设计表格来辅助布局 | 设计个人履历模板 | √ | × | × | × | × | × |
分录表格 | BOSV5.0.013及以上 | 常用于打印分录明细数据且需自定义分录数据打印的表格样式 | 将资产单据体分录数据打印成资产卡片样式 | √ | √ | √ | × | × | × |
#往期推荐#
数据表格、布局网格、分录表格傻傻分不清?这篇使用指南帮你厘清!
本文2024-09-23 00:36:55发表“云苍穹知识”栏目。
本文链接:https://wenku.my7c.com/article/kingdee-cangqiong-140606.html